The Chiba Prefectural Psychiatric Medical Center is the primary psychiatric hospital operated by the Prefecture. It plays a crucial role in providing mental health services to the community. The center is dedicated to offering comprehensive care and support for individuals facing mental health challenges.
One of the most important services offered by the Chiba Prefectural Psychiatric Medical Center is its emergency hotline. Available 24 hours a day seven days a week. The hotline provides immediate assistance to those in crisis. This ensures that individuals can receive the help they need. It does not matter the time of day or night.
The Chiba Prefectural Psychiatric Medical Center’s emergency hotline can provide information about clinics and hospitals. These clinics and hospitals can receive patients after hours or during holidays. This service is invaluable for ensuring continuous access to care. While using the services of the Chiba Prefectural Psychiatric Medical Center requires Japanese language proficiency. This requirement ensures effective communication and accurate understanding. It allows the staff to provide the best possible care.
